Actor Micheal Ward Acquitted of Rape and Sexual Assault Charges in UK Court

British actor Micheal Ward, known for his roles in 'Top Boy' and 'Small Axe,' has been cleared of all five charges of rape and sexual assault following a 10-day trial at Snaresbrook Crown Court in London.

Micheal Ward, the 28-year-old actor celebrated for his compelling performances, was on Wednesday, January 1, 1970, acquitted of two counts of rape, two counts of assault by penetration, and one count of sexual assault. The verdict came after a rigorous 10-day trial at Snaresbrook Crown Court in London. The charges stemmed from an encounter with a woman Ward met at a New Year's Day party in London in 2023.

**Micheal Ward:** A prominent British actor, Ward rose to fame for his role as Jamie Tovell in the Netflix crime drama series *Top Boy*. He also received critical acclaim for his performance in Steve McQueen's *Small Axe* anthology, specifically the film *Lovers Rock*. His career, which began with modeling, quickly transitioned into acting, earning him a BAFTA Rising Star Award in 2020. **Snaresbrook Crown Court:** Located in East London, Snaresbrook Crown Court is a significant facility within the UK's criminal justice system. Crown Courts handle the most serious criminal cases, including trials for offences like rape and sexual assault, which are heard before a judge and jury. **"Top Boy" and "Small Axe":** These are two significant works that define Micheal Ward's acting career. *Top Boy* is a gritty British crime drama, initially broadcast on Channel 4 and later revived by Netflix, depicting the lives of drug dealers and residents on a fictional estate in East London. *Small Axe* is an anthology film series directed by Steve McQueen for the BBC and Amazon Prime Video, exploring the lives of West Indian immigrants in London from the late 1960s to the early 1980s. **Rape, Sexual Assault, and Assault by Penetration:** In UK law, these are grave criminal offences. **Rape** involves the intentional penetration of the vagina, anus, or mouth with a penis without consent. **Sexual Assault** refers to intentionally touching another person sexually without their consent. **Assault by Penetration** involves the non-consensual penetration of another person's anus or vagina with a part of the body (other than a penis) or an object. Being **acquitted** or **cleared** means that, after hearing all the evidence, the jury found the accused not guilty of the charges, or the charges were otherwise dismissed, legally ending the matter.
